What companies run services between Rodez, France and Genoa, Italy?

Volotea flies from Rodez-Marcillac Airport (RDZ) to Genoa Cristoforo Colombo Airport (GOA) 3 times a week. Alternatively, you can take a bus from RODEZ - Gare SNCF/Routière to Genoa via Millau and Montpellier in around 14h 5m.
